Matt Lyford
About Matt Lyford
Matt Lyford is an Electrical Design Engineer with extensive experience in designing systems for scientific applications, particularly in ultra-high vacuum and cryogenic environments. He has worked at AWE in various engineering roles and currently contributes to the Diamond Light Source in Oxford.
Current Role at Diamond Light Source
Matt Lyford has been serving as an Electrical Design Engineer at Diamond Light Source since 2019. In this role, he is responsible for developing vacuum control systems and safety circuits. His work focuses on the design of electron accelerators and beamlines, utilizing his expertise in programmable logic controllers and distributed I/O systems. His contributions are essential for the operation of advanced scientific research facilities.
Previous Experience at AWE
Matt Lyford has extensive experience at AWE, where he worked from 2000 to 2019 in various engineering roles. He began as an Apprentice and progressed to Electronics Engineer, Senior Commissioning Engineer, Technical Lead, and Control System Engineer. His responsibilities included designing precision motion control systems and contributing to ultra-high vacuum environments and cryogenic temperature operations. His tenure at AWE spanned nearly two decades, providing him with a solid foundation in electrical engineering.
Education and Qualifications
Matt Lyford studied at Newbury College, where he achieved City & Guilds qualifications in Electrical Installations and Electrical & Electronic Servicing. He furthered his education by obtaining an HNC in Electronic/Electrical Engineering between 2004 and 2006. In 2020, he completed the 18th Edition Wiring Regulations course, enhancing his knowledge of electrical standards and practices.
